单片机煤气报警系统的设计与实现

版权申诉
0 下载量 74 浏览量 更新于2024-10-31 收藏 1MB ZIP 举报
资源摘要信息:"参考资料-基于单片机的煤气报警系统.zip" 知识点: 1. 单片机概念及应用:单片机是一种集成电路芯片,其内部集成了CPU、RAM、ROM、I/O接口等主要计算机部件,能够进行数据处理和控制功能。在本压缩包中,它被应用于煤气报警系统中,这体现了单片机在嵌入式硬件领域的广泛应用。 2. 嵌入式硬件:嵌入式硬件通常指的是嵌入式系统中的硬件部分,包括处理器、存储器、输入输出设备等。在煤气报警系统中,嵌入式硬件作为整个系统的物理基础,负责接收、处理传感器传来的数据,以及触发报警等功能。 3. 煤气报警系统原理:煤气报警系统通常由气体传感器、单片机、报警装置等部分构成。气体传感器负责检测煤气浓度,当煤气浓度超过设定的安全范围时,会向单片机发送信号。单片机接收到信号后,会判断煤气浓度是否超标,并作出相应处理,如开启报警装置,提醒人们采取措施。 4. 传感器技术:在煤气报警系统中,传感器技术的应用是至关重要的。传感器能够感应到煤气的存在,并将其转换为电信号,再由单片机进行处理。常见的煤气传感器有半导体式和催化燃烧式。 5. 报警系统设计:本压缩包提供的参考资料可能包含了煤气报警系统的具体设计过程,包括硬件选择、电路设计、程序编写等方面。设计一个好的报警系统,需要考虑到响应速度、准确性、稳定性等多方面的因素。 6. 系统测试与调试:在单片机系统开发过程中,系统测试与调试是一个重要环节。只有通过严格的测试,才能确保煤气报警系统的稳定运行。测试可能包括功能测试、性能测试、环境适应性测试等。 7. 安全规范与标准:在设计和实施煤气报警系统时,需要遵守相关的安全规范和标准。例如,气体报警器的设置位置、报警响应时间、报警声音大小等都有一定的规范要求。 8. 硬件编程语言:单片机通常使用C语言或汇编语言进行编程。本压缩包可能包含了相关的程序代码,供学习者参考。掌握硬件编程语言对于理解和开发煤气报警系统至关重要。 9. 用户交互设计:煤气报警系统的用户交互设计也是一个重要方面。这涉及到如何设计用户界面,以及如何通过声音、灯光或其他方式让用户明白报警信息。 10. 系统维护与升级:在煤气报警系统的整个生命周期中,维护和升级是不可忽视的环节。本压缩包可能也包含了关于如何维护和升级系统的知识,以确保系统的长期有效运行。 综上所述,"参考资料-基于单片机的煤气报警系统.zip"为我们提供了一个关于单片机应用、嵌入式硬件设计、传感器技术、系统测试与调试等方面的综合性学习资源。通过对本压缩包的学习,我们可以全面了解和掌握单片机在煤气报警系统中的应用,并学习到如何设计、开发、测试、维护和升级一个实用的嵌入式硬件系统。